Transaction 8a4bda70d158bec9920cbca3303354164ba5e04ea53f7aec082cbb52090ec5c8

1 Input
2 Outputs
  • 8a4bda70d158bec9920cbca3303354164ba5e04ea53f7aec082cbb52090ec5c8:0
  • value  261100
    address  17W3PKtMEDEDmSwXd1WkrnKLex3jT7b8Ua
  • 8a4bda70d158bec9920cbca3303354164ba5e04ea53f7aec082cbb52090ec5c8:1
  • value  51126398
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C